Career path

Career Role Description
Water Conservation Landscape Designer Designs sustainable and water-wise gardens and outdoor spaces, incorporating drought-tolerant plants and efficient irrigation systems. High demand for eco-conscious design.
Irrigation Technician (Water-Wise Systems) Installs, maintains, and repairs water-efficient irrigation systems, ensuring optimal water usage and plant health. Growing sector with increasing automation.
Water-Wise Horticulturalist Specializes in the cultivation and management of plants suited to water-scarce environments, promoting sustainable landscaping practices. Expertise in drought-tolerant species is key.
Sustainable Drainage Systems (SuDS) Engineer Designs and implements SuDS to manage stormwater runoff effectively, minimizing water pollution and conserving water resources. Essential for urban water management.
